This top floor flat one bedroom flat will make an ideal project home, for any first time buyer, downsizer or buy to let investor wanting a nice location to live in. The property is of a good size inside, offering you a nice light and airy accommodation but will need modernisation. Although it has had a refitted wet room style shower room and also benefits from having it's own balcony with pleasant views over the communal gardens below. Inside the flat you have a hall with a useful storage cupboard, a good size twin aspect living room with a dated kitchen and balcony off. You have a good size twin aspect double bedroom with access to a refitted shower room. Within the block you have a your traditional security intercom system with a lift. Outside surrounding the block you have nice, well maintained landscaped communal gardens with on road parking provided both on Kimbolton Road or Kimbolton Avenue. The lease currently stands at 939 years unexpired, there is a yearly service charge of £840.00 and there is no ground rent to pay. The council tax band is A and the EPC is rated E.
Location
Situated on the renowned Kimbolton Road within easy access to a local Budgens Store, Park Pub/Restaurant and Bedford Park. Close by you have access to Bedford University, regular bus services and the town centre with it's shopping centres and stores. If you commute then Bedford's Railway Station provides you with fast train services into London within about forty minutes. If you commute by car, then Bedford bypass is only a short drive away offering you excellent road links to the A1, M1, A6 and A600.
